Indonesia intensifies search for victims after floods, landslides kill 49 people

Rescuers searched on Thursday (November 27, 2025) in rivers and the rubble of villages for bodies, and when possible survivors, after flash floods and landslides on Indonesia’s Sumatra island left 49 people dead and 67 missing. Monsoon rains over the past week caused rivers to burst their banks in North Sumatra province Tuesday. The deluge…
